Abstract

Densities (ρ), and ultrasonic speeds (u) of {difurylmethane + (methanol or ethanol or propan-1-ol or butan-1-ol or pentan-1-ol or hexan-1-ol)} binary mixtures have been measured over the entire composition range at T = 298.15 K and atmospheric pressure. Excess isentropic compressibility coefficient, κsE, excess ultrasonic speeds, uE and excess intermolecular free length, LfE, of each binary system were calculated and correlated by the Redlich–Kister equation. The results are discussed in terms of possible intermolecular interactions and structural effects.
